The Sisterhood is the first and only safe space in Jakarta that is run by women refugees and for women refugees. Our community center in South Jakarta, Indonesia, serves as a vital refuge where we stand together against gender-based violence and support each other in our fight for refugee rights in Indonesia. It’s a place where we don’t feel alone and where refugee women in Indonesia can feel at home. We find strength in Sisterhood.

 Since 2018, over 1,200 women refugees in Indonesia have participated in our activities—both online and at our community centre in Jakarta. We overcome social isolation, make lasting friendships, and gain confidence through new skills. The Sisterhood is a Community of Empowerment in the fight against gender-based violence and promoting refugee women's rights.

As a women refugee-led organisation, our mission is to strengthen the bonds between women of all faiths and backgrounds and to promote the rights and well-being of refugee women, especially those facing gender-based violence. Our members come from diverse countries including Afghanistan, Cameroon, Eritrea, Iran, Iraq, Palestine, Pakistan, Somalia, and Yemen.

We offer weekly classes in English literacy, computer literacy, tailoring, handicrafts, hairdressing, and make-up, which support the empowerment of refugee women in Indonesia. These programs also play a vital role in addressing gender-based violence and promoting refugee rights in Indonesia through our refugee-led organization.

We raise awareness, advocate, and organise in our communities to empower refugee women in Indonesia to know and claim their rights, particularly in the context of gender-based violence. As a refugee-led organisation, we also advocate at local, regional, and international levels to promote refugee rights and women's rights.
